Terracotta saucer-shaped oil lamp
Open, wheel-made. Broad, horizontal rim, pinched into a narrow, projecting nozzle, and an uneven, flat base. Intact. Length: 5 5/8 in. (14.3 cm) Height: 1 13/16 in. (4.6 cm)
